Understanding X12 EDI Standards

To grasp essentials of X12 digital communication protocols, it's crucial to realize they are a collection of predetermined rules. These directives dictate how organizations transmit documents, typically regarding purchase orders, invoices, and other commercial transactions. X12 specifications were originally developed by the Accredited Standards Committee (ASC) X12, and they provide a organized way to simplify supply chain processes, minimizing manual effort and errors. Each transaction uses specific sections and codes that must adhere to the documented criteria, ensuring alignment between different systems.

Demystifying X12 Transaction Sets

Understanding intricate X12 electronic formats can seem daunting , but it doesn't have to be a mystery. These standardized documents are the backbone of electronic data exchange between businesses, primarily in industries like healthcare and supply logistics . Essentially, they’re pre-defined templates that specify how information – from purchase orders to invoices – is structured and communicated. Think of them as a universal protocol for computers to “talk” to each other regarding business data. They consist of segments, which are blocks of related data, identified by three-character codes. While the specifics differ based on the purpose – an 850 is for purchase orders, a 275 is for health insurance payment advice -- the fundamental concept remains the same: consistent formatting enables automated processing and reduces errors.

  • They outline data elements
  • They use standard codes
  • They ensure interoperability
It’s less about memorizing every code (though that's helpful!) and more about grasping this underlying framework.
